Senior/ Software Developer -- iOS (Defi)

Crypto.com logo

Crypto.com

View Salaries, Reviews, and more  

Job Summary


Job Type
-

Seniority
Senior

Years of Experience
Information not provided

Tech Stacks
Objective C play Combine RxSwift MVVM UIKit Git iOS Swift C

Job Description

Responsibilities

  • Work closely with product team and play an active role in providing feedbacks, to help shape our features
  • Passionate about software engineering and love to build mobile apps and systems
  • Care about code quality, robustness and end user experience
  • Mastery in Swift or Objective C
  • Familiar with ReactiveX (a plus)
  • Built projects you are proud of (big plus if they are side projects)

Requirement

  • Minimum of 5 years of full-time iOS development experience (no upper limit)
  • Proficiency in Swift, UIKit and a solid understanding of iOS development best practices.
  • Familiarity with MVVM architecture (experience with SnapKit and RxSwift/Combine is highly desirable)
  • Experience in writing unit tests and snapshot/UI tests
  • Proficiency in Git and familiarity with branching models such as Git-flow, Trunk Based Development, etc.
  • Strong problem-solving skills and a passion for continuous learning.
  • Excellent communication and collaboration abilities.
  • A focus on producing high-quality code and exceptional user experiences.
  • Candidates with more experience will be considered as senior developer.

Interview Questions of Senior/ Software Developer -- iOS (Defi) at Crypto.com

Interview questions from Crypto.com that are similar to Senior/ Software Developer -- iOS (Defi)
View more interview questions from Crypto.com โ†’
Unlock Your Interview Potential
The only end-to-end front end interview preparation platform by FAANG ex-interviewers and Staff Engineers.
Get hired at FAANG
Users now work at:

Achieve your dream job with our top-notch tools!

Resume Checker Illustration

Resume Checker

Our free resume checker analyzes the job description and identifies important keywords and skills missing from your resume in just a minute!

Check Now
Interview Preparation Illustration

AI InterviewPrep

Utilizing advanced AI, our tool generates tailored interview questions based on your industry, role, and experience. Practice and receive feedback on your answers in real time!

Check Now
Resume Builder Illustration

Resume Builder

Let us show you the differences between a bad, good, and great resume, and guide you in building a resume that helps you stand out to employers, ensuring you land your next position faster!

Check Now